[Qemu-devel] [PULL 32/37] qemu-iotests: fix -valgrind option for check

Commit 934659c switched the iotests to run qemu-io from a bash subshell,
in order to catch segfaults. This method is incompatible with the
current valgrind_qemu_io() bash function.
Move the valgrind usage into the exec subshell in _qemu_io_wrapper(),
while making sure the original return value is passed back to the
caller.
Update test output for tests 039, 061, and 137 as it looks for the
specific subshell command when the process is terminated.

diff --git a/tests/qemu-iotests/common.config b/tests/qemu-iotests/common.config
index be99730..3ed51b8 100644
--- a/tests/qemu-iotests/common.config
+++ b/tests/qemu-iotests/common.config
@@ -122,7 +122,23 @@ _qemu_img_wrapper()
_qemu_io_wrapper()
{
- (exec "$QEMU_IO_PROG" $QEMU_IO_OPTIONS "$@")
+ local VALGRIND_LOGFILE=/tmp/$$.valgrind
+ local RETVAL
+ (
+ if [ "${VALGRIND_QEMU}" == "y" ]; then
+ exec valgrind --log-file="${VALGRIND_LOGFILE}" --error-exitcode=99
"$QEMU_IO_PROG" $QEMU_IO_OPTIONS "$@"
+ else
+ exec "$QEMU_IO_PROG" $QEMU_IO_OPTIONS "$@"
+ fi
+ )
+ RETVAL=$?
+ if [ "${VALGRIND_QEMU}" == "y" ]; then
+ if [ $RETVAL == 99 ]; then
+ cat "${VALGRIND_LOGFILE}"
+ fi
+ rm -f "${VALGRIND_LOGFILE}"
+ fi
+ (exit $RETVAL)
}
